文件名称:gopherjs-demo:一个演示项目,展示了如何使用 GopherJS 在 Go 和 JS 应用程序之间共享 Go 代码
文件大小:8KB
文件格式:ZIP
更新时间:2024-07-10 11:01:44
Go
gopherjs-演示 一个演示项目,展示了如何使用 GopherJS 在 Go 和 JS 应用程序之间共享 Go 代码 设置 安装gopherjs作为命令行工具 go get -u github.com/gopherjs/gopherjs 宠物 一个 Go 结构体被导出以用于 JS 代码的简单示例。 cd pet/js gopherjs build main.go node index.js 用户 一个更复杂的 Go 库示例,可以在 Go 和 JS 应用程序之间重用。 请注意,为简洁起见, user示例并未包含应有的类型检查。 例如, RegisterDBJS(jsdb)应该检查jsdb是否确实包含Query()函数。 在 Go 中测试: cd user/go go run main.go 在 NodeJS 中测试: cd user/js gopherjs buil
【文件预览】:
gopherjs-demo-master
----.gitignore(26B)
----LICENSE(1KB)
----user()
--------user.go(1KB)
--------js()
--------go()
----README.md(765B)
----pet()
--------js()
--------pet.go(270B)